A home treadmill is a fitness device designed for running or walking while remaining in one place. Unlike standard running outside, it permits individuals to work out in the comfort of their homes. Treadmills can be powered by electrical energy or can be manual, requiring the user to move the belt with their own effort.

When looking for a home treadmill, it's important to examine specific functions that boost the workout experience. Specific features to focus on include:
Motor Power: Look for a motor with a minimum of 2.0 CHP for trusted efficiency.Running Surface: A larger running surface is more effective, particularly for those who desire to run or take longer strides.Incline Options: Adjustable slopes increase workout strength and aid engage different muscle groups.Cushioning System: Good shock absorption can considerably lower the effect on joints and prevent injuries.Technology Integration: Built-in heart rate displays, Bluetooth connection, and integrated workout programs can improve your physical fitness journey.Upkeep Tips for Your Treadmill
A well-maintained treadmill can last for years. Routine maintenance is crucial to making sure optimal performance. Consider these maintenance tips:
Keep It Clean: Wipe down the surface area regularly to remove dust and sweat.Lubricate the Belt: Apply silicone lube according to producer standards to reduce friction.Look for Wear and Tear: Regularly examine the belt and deck for indications of damage or extreme wear.Check the Motor: Clean dust from the motor location and ensure proper ventilation to avoid getting too hot.Follow User Manual: Always refer to the user manual for specific upkeep guidelines associated with the model.Frequently Asked Questions about Home Treadmills1. 2. How much space do I require for a treadmill?
While it differs by design, a common home treadmill will need at least 6.5 feet in length and 3 feet in width.
